Hello All
After installing a new LC (DS-X9248-256k9), the blade is at powered-dn state.
Reason: Reset (powered-down) because of incompatible configuration
# show hardware fabric-mode
Fabric mode does not support FCoE, Gen4 and above linecards
Following is the configuration on the Cisco MDS-9509 switch
1/2/4/8/10 Gbps Advanced FC Module (DS-X9248-256K9)
Supervisor/Fabric-2 (DS-X9530-SF2-K9)
Fabric Module (Xbar-3)
NX-OS release 5.2(2d)
Please advise

Hi Chetan,
See the link below for detailed instructions, but you need to:
(1)remove broadcast zoning if configured
(2)reload the switch.
Migrating to Cisco MDS 8-Gbps Advanced Fibre Channel Module
To migrate to the Cisco MDS 9000 48-port 8-Gbps Advanced Fibre Channel module (DS-X9248-256K9) or to the Cisco MDS 9000 32-port 8-Gbps Advanced Fibre Channel module (DS-X9232-256K9), follow these steps:
Step 1 - Upgrade to Cisco MDS NX-OS Release 5.2 or a later release. Follow the correct upgrade path for your switch:
–From all 5.0(x) releases, you can upgrade directly to Cisco MDS NX-OS Release 5.2.
–From all 4.2(x) and 4.1(x) releases, upgrade to any 5.0(x), release and then upgrade to NX-OS Release 5.2 or a later release.
–From all SAN-OS 3.3(x) releases, upgrade to the latest NX-OS 4.x release, upgrade to any 5.0(x) release, and then upgrade to NX-OS Release 5.2 or a later release.
–From all SAN-OS 3.2(x), 3.1(x), and 3.0(x) releases, upgrade to any 3.3(x) release, upgrade to the latest NX-OS Release 4.x, and then upgrade to any 5.0(x) release, and then upgrade to NX-OS Release 5.2 or a later release.
–For additional upgrade paths from earlier releases, see the Cisco MDS 9000 Release Notes for MDS NX-OS Release 5.2(1).
Step 2 - Install the Fabric 3 module in the Cisco MDS 9513 Director to use the full bandwidth capability of the 8-Gbps Advanced Fibre Channel modules. To install a Fabric 3 module, refer to the "Upgrading to Fabric 3 Module" section.
Note The 256-Gbps bandwidth capability of the 8-Gbps Advanced Fibre Channel modules require the Fabric 3 module in the Cisco MDS 9513 Director.
Step 3- Perform a switch reload. In certain migration scenarios a switch reload is required for the Cisco MDS 9513 Director to change to the fabric mode that supports the Generation 4 module.
Step 4 - Install the Cisco MDS 9000 48-port 8-Gbps Advanced Fibre Channel module (DS-X9248-256K9) or the Cisco MDS 9000 32-port 8-Gbps Advanced Fibre Channel module (DS-X9232-256K9).
